Manuel y Clemente

Country: Spain, Language: Spanish, German, 89 mins

  • Director: Javier Palmero
  • Writer: Javier Palmero
  • Producer: Gunner Andersen, Fernando Bauluz, Concepción de Diego

CGiii Comment

Manuel and Clemente, couple in the shower and in various scheming, try to do business with miraculous apparitions. Near the Sevillian town of El Palmar de Troya, in 1968, people begin to say that the Virgin appears and the two friends take advantage of the situation. Soon a network of economic interests and credulity is created that makes it easier for Manuel and Clemente to achieve their goal: a monumental basilica, a religious order of nuns, priests and bishops of their own, and even a pope, Gregory XVII. Satire on the curious origin of the Palmarian Catholic Church and its unique founders.
